Klein
From the south of London, Klein develops a body of work at the crossroads of experimental music, contemporary R&B, British rap, dark ambient and, more recently, a more rock-oriented writing. Of Nigerian origin, Klein first drew attention with independent releases like Only and Lagata in 2016, before releasing the EP Tommy in 2017 on Hyperdub. His music assembles fragmented voices, distorted samples, abrasive, noise-like textures, spoken word and often disjointed structures, in a language that borrows as much from club culture as from gospel, theatre and more noise forms. Klein also collaborated with Laurel Halo, appearing on the Dust album in 2017, and his work goes beyond the strict frame of the record, with scene-related projects such as the musical Care, presented at the ICA in London in 2018. His discography subsequently expanded with Lifetime in 2019, Frozen in 2020, Harmattan in 2021, then Cave in the Wind and Star in the Hood in 2022, touched by an angel in 2023, marked in 2024, as well as thirteen sense and sleep with a cane in 2025. Through these publications, Klein develops a very free sonic writing, where the codes of R&B and the experimental are constantly displaced.
